Visual Basic - Boton de BUSCAR

Life is soft - evento anual de software empresarial
 
Vista:
sin imagen de perfil
Val: 2
Ha disminuido su posición en 31 puestos en Visual Basic (en relación al último mes)
Gráfica de Visual Basic

Boton de BUSCAR

Publicado por Snake (1 intervención) el 23/10/2020 18:07:00
Buenos días

Soy Nuevo en esto de la programación así que inicie en Visual Basic 6.0, inicio con mi historia quiero hacer un sistema de inventario de computadoras ingresando IP, SISTEMA OPERATIVO, MODELO, etc., donde tengo los botones de NUEVO, ELIMINAR, GUARDAR y BUSCAR el problema que tengo es con el botón BUSCAR ya que no encuentro la manera de buscar la información dentro de un textbox ( que es la IP) cabe mencionar que en mi base de datos el campo IP está declarada tipo texto.

Me gustaría que cuando de clic en el botón BUSCAR me aparezca una pantalla donde deba escribir la IP y si en dado caso no existe o no la encuentra envié mensaje de que NO EXISTE y si existe enviar todo los datos en pantalla.
Espero a verme explicado

mi codigo

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
Private Sub btmBuscar_Click()
AQUI FALTA MI CODIGO
End Sub
 
Private Sub btmSalir1_Click()
End
End Sub
 
Private Sub Command1_Click()
Data1.UpdateRecord
Data1.Refresh
MsgBox "El Registro ha sido Guardado en la Base de Datos", vbExclamation, "Aviso Importante"
End Sub
 
Private Sub Command3_Click()
If MsgBox("¿Quieres Eliminar la IP Número: " & Text1 & "?", 16 + 4) = 6 Then
Data1.Recordset.Delete
Data1.Refresh
Text1.SetFocus
MsgBox "Se Eliminó la IP", vbCritical, "Aviso Importante"
Else
MsgBox "No se Eliminó la IP Número: " & Text1, vbExclamation, "Aviso Importante"
End If
End Sub
 
Private Sub Command4_Click()
Data1.Recordset.AddNew
End Sub


G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
sin imagen de perfil
Val: 355
Bronce
Ha mantenido su posición en Visual Basic (en relación al último mes)
Gráfica de Visual Basic

Boton de BUSCAR

Publicado por raul (160 intervenciones) el 24/10/2020 00:08:06
Hola SNAKE, por lo que infiero en tu consulta estas usando una conexión de acceso tipo DAO que desde hace mucho tiempo no empleo, verifica si te funciona este codigo.

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
Private sub BUSCAR()
on local error goto et 'Mecanismo para controlar errores
DIM PCIP as string, tmp as string, ID_ACTUAL as integer
PCIP = imputbox("Ingrese la IP de la PC a buscar")
'1- Comprobar que se han ingresado datos
if len(PCIP) =0 then
msgbox"Operación Cancelada: No se ha ingresado ninguna IP para buscar", vbcritical
exit sub
end if
'2- Crear la cadena a buscar
tmp = "IP = '" & PCIP & "'"
'3- Mecanismo de busqueda
ID_actual = data1.bookmark
data1.recordset.FindFirst tmp
exit sub
et: 'Usualmente se produce un error si no encuentra el dato
err.clear
data1.recordset.move ID_actual ' Regresar al registro anterior a que se produjera un error
msgbox"La IP " & PCIP & " no se encuentra registrada en sus sistema".
end sub
 
 
 
Private Sub btmBuscar_Click()
Call BUSCAR
End Sub
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il
Val: 119
Ha disminuido 1 puesto en Visual Basic (en relación al último mes)
Gráfica de Visual Basic

Boton de BUSCAR

Publicado por christian (713 intervenciones) el 24/10/2020 04:55:00
Hola amigo.
Primero te recomiendo que veas cómo hacer un CRUD con ADO
Aprende sobre el objeto connection, recordset y command.
No sé que base utilizas, aprende SQL. SELECT, INSERT, UPDATE Y DELETE


Te aseguro que aprendiendo esto en vb6, luego lo vas a mejorar en .NET ya sea con VB.NET o con C#.

si quieres tienes mi correo y enviándome el código te lo paso bien explicado.

saludos.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ar